Properties
Description
Sucrose phosphorylase from Escherichia coli is responsible for catalyzing sucrose transformation to glucose and fructose.
Molecular Weight
56 kDa
Unit Definition
One unit will produce 1.0 μmole of D-fructose from sucrose per min with the corresponding reduction of NADP to NADPH at pH 7.6, at 25°C.
Source
Escherichia coli
Form
Lyophilized powder
Applications
Sucrose phosphorylase from Escherichia coli can be used in sucrose measurement in wheat plants and sucrose hydrogen production.
Storage
Store at -20°C.
